better logging Signed-off-by: olivier lamy <[email protected]>
Project: http://git-wip-us.apache.org/repos/asf/maven-indexer/repo Commit: http://git-wip-us.apache.org/repos/asf/maven-indexer/commit/ce2f8317 Tree: http://git-wip-us.apache.org/repos/asf/maven-indexer/tree/ce2f8317 Diff: http://git-wip-us.apache.org/repos/asf/maven-indexer/diff/ce2f8317 Branch: refs/heads/master Commit: ce2f8317d234ed1a4a9c1f49d4d79506ce933eaf Parents: a354f5c Author: olivier lamy <[email protected]> Authored: Mon Jul 24 11:56:31 2017 +1000 Committer: olivier lamy <[email protected]> Committed: Mon Jul 24 11:56:31 2017 +1000 ---------------------------------------------------------------------- .../apache/maven/index/locator/ArtifactLocator.java | 14 +++++++------- 1 file changed, 7 insertions(+), 7 deletions(-) ---------------------------------------------------------------------- http://git-wip-us.apache.org/repos/asf/maven-indexer/blob/ce2f8317/indexer-core/src/main/java/org/apache/maven/index/locator/ArtifactLocator.java ---------------------------------------------------------------------- diff --git a/indexer-core/src/main/java/org/apache/maven/index/locator/ArtifactLocator.java b/indexer-core/src/main/java/org/apache/maven/index/locator/ArtifactLocator.java index f4feb34..d83b3a4 100644 --- a/indexer-core/src/main/java/org/apache/maven/index/locator/ArtifactLocator.java +++ b/indexer-core/src/main/java/org/apache/maven/index/locator/ArtifactLocator.java @@ -31,6 +31,8 @@ import org.apache.maven.index.artifact.GavCalculator; import org.apache.maven.model.Model; import org.apache.maven.model.io.xpp3.MavenXpp3Reader; import org.codehaus.plexus.util.xml.pull.XmlPullParserException; +import org.slf4j.Logger; +import org.slf4j.LoggerFactory; /** * Artifact locator. @@ -40,6 +42,9 @@ import org.codehaus.plexus.util.xml.pull.XmlPullParserException; public class ArtifactLocator implements GavHelpedLocator { + + private static final Logger LOGGER = LoggerFactory.getLogger( ArtifactLocator.class ); + private final ArtifactPackagingMapper mapper; public ArtifactLocator( ArtifactPackagingMapper mapper ) @@ -83,14 +88,9 @@ public class ArtifactLocator return artifact; } - catch ( IOException e ) - { - e.printStackTrace(); - return null; - } - catch ( XmlPullParserException e ) + catch ( XmlPullParserException | IOException e ) { - e.printStackTrace(); + LOGGER.warn( "skip error reading pom from file:" + source, e ); return null; } }
